Resume Tips
From e-resume.net®
Objective Statement. If you use an objective at the top of your resume, make sure it is not too generic. Why not replace your generic statement with an objective that uses specific keywords to describe how you want to use your specific skills to benefit the company.
Inaccuracies. While you should watch for inaccuracies in the body of your resume, you should also make sure that all of your contact information is correct. If you transpose a digit in your phone number or do not update an address, an employer is not going to waste his or her time tracking you down. They will simply move on to the next if they cannot reach you because you gave them wrong contact information.
The executive resume is for seasoned professionals, including C-level executives, directors, vice-presidents and politicians. Executive resumes tend to be two to three pages in length and are aggressively worded.
